Mass of Solar Prominences Estimated from Multi-Wavelength Data

The mass of selected prominences was estimated using their multi-wavelength observations: in H alpha by the HSFA2 spectrograph of the Ondrejov observatory, in EUV by SoHO/EIT and in the soft X-rays by Hillock XRT. The results are compared with values estimated by other authors.
